Transaction 17ac4ae5024318ddaf4cb3a6515da3b1b077f2a1ec240844a15aa439c8a0381b
1 Input
1 Output
-
17ac4ae5024318ddaf4cb3a6515da3b1b077f2a1ec240844a15aa439c8a0381b:0
- value
- 13122844
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f89dbe858760cf3f3f99d23f3e50fc5fdf5867f
- address
- bc1q37yah6zcwcx08ulen53l8eg0ch7ltpnl046652